FAQ

What is Dolby Laboratories, Inc.'s inventories?
Dolby Laboratories, Inc. (DLB) reported inventories of $31.93M in Q1 2026.
How has Dolby Laboratories, Inc.'s inventories changed year-over-year?
Dolby Laboratories, Inc.'s inventories decreased by 7.7% year-over-year, from $34.59M to $31.93M.
What is the long-term trend for Dolby Laboratories, Inc.'s inventories?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Dolby Laboratories, Inc.'s inventories has grown at a 29.1%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$10.97M to $30.42M.
What does inventories mean?
Total inventory including raw materials, work-in-progress, and finished goods, valued at the lower of cost or net realizable value.
